In abstract algebra, the free monoid on a set is the monoid whose elements are all the finite sequences or strings of zero or more elements from that set, with string concatenation as the monoid operation and with the unique sequence of zero elements, often called the empty string and denoted by. The element is called the identity or unit and is usually denoted by. A term used as an abbreviation for the phrase semigroup with identity. More generally, in category theory, the morphisms of an object to itself form a monoid, and, conversely, a monoid may be viewed as a category with a single object.
